What is the true identity of Cheng, whose ancestors are equally famous with Guo Jia?

As we all know, when it comes to the heroic journey of Sui and Tang Dynasties, a simple and honest look may emerge in everyone's mind. In the novels and TV dramas you saw, he was born in a poor family and raised by a lonely old mother. Later, he was arrested for smuggling salt and was almost beheaded. His life should not be doomed, just in time for Yang Guang's accession to the throne and his amnesty, and he was released from prison. Originally, he listened to his mother's words and sold firewood honestly. As a result, he met You Junda, a noisy horse. Under You Junda's bluff, he robbed Yang Lin's emperor, causing trouble, and 36 people in Jia Gulou became sworn friends.

After that, he became a crock master with the support of everyone, and later gave way to Shi Biao. However, Shi Biao's own status has improved, and he gradually ignored the general crock, which caused the two brothers to break up. Cheng and others defected to Zheng Wang and Wang. But after a long time, Cheng found that Wang, who looked brave on the surface, was actually narrow-minded and not a good man. So he defected to Li Shimin again.

But in fact, Cheng was not born in poverty, and he didn't do anything to rob the emperor. His great-grandfather was a famous Yanzhou Sima in Northern Qi Dynasty, his grandfather was a Jinzhou Sima in Northern Qi Dynasty, and his father was a Jeju Taisho. During the Wei and Jin Dynasties, the system of "Nine Grades Being Right" was implemented, and the position of Cheng's father was responsible for evaluating the rank of local gentry officials, which had great power. Therefore, Cheng was not born in poverty, but in a good family.
